An investment scam involves fraudsters tricking individuals into investing money with the promise of high returns. Scammers often present opportunities that seem too good to be true, such as guaranteed profits or exclusive deals. They may claim the investment is low-risk or even risk-free. Fraudsters use persuasive tactics to gain trust. They might create fake websites or use official-looking documents to appear legitimate. Some scammers pressure potential victims by creating a sense of urgency, insisting that the opportunity is limited or time-sensitive. Scammers also exploit emotions, promising financial freedom or a chance to achieve dreams quickly. They often target vulnerable individuals who are eager to improve their financial situation. Many scams rely on word-of-mouth, encouraging victims to recruit family and friends, spreading the deceit further.
